RELATION OF CULTURE
AND LANGUAGE
 Language is the most powerful way in the communication world.
 Kramsch identifies three ways how language and culture are bound together.
 First, language expresses cultural reality. (with words people express facts and
ideas)
 Second, language embodies cultural reality. (people give meaning to their
experience)
 Third, language symbolizes cultural reality. (people view their language as a
symbol of their identity)
LANGUAGE AND POPULAR
CULTURE/POP-CULTURE
 Popular culture /pop culture refers to the systems and practices used by the majority classes
in a society. Language is changeable phenomena and pop-culture is a powerful source in this
context.
 The movie with the biggest weekend gross box office total, the number one song on the
Billboard charts, the most widely read books and the highest ranking television show in the
Nielsen ratings are important elements of U.S. popular culture. It can be seen that these things
affect the language of particular society.
 Various forms of popular culture include music, film, television, advertising, sports,
fashion, toys, magazines and comic books, and cyber culture.
 All these things have effects on language of the particular society. Language and culture are
inter related and this relationship can be evaluated through their impact on each other.
